The Creature has balanced effects.

The Creature is a modern sativa cultivar resulting from a genetic crossing of Sativa, Chimera, and the White Truffle cut. This strain is cultivated exclusively in outdoor environments and necessitates a moderate level of grower expertise. With a lengthy flowering period of 105 days, the plant produces a medium yield, reflecting its unique developmental cycle and specific environmental requirements.

The chemical profile of The Creature is defined by a complex arrangement of terpenes, led by caryophyllene and limonene, followed by humulene, myrcene, linalool, beta-pinene, pinene, and bisabolol. This layering of compounds shapes the sensory experience, grounding the sharp, citrus-forward notes of limonene with the spicy, woody undertones provided by caryophyllene and humulene. The presence of trace floral and pine-like influences from the secondary and tertiary terpenes adds nuance to the overall olfactory and flavor profile.

As a THC-dominant variety, The Creature is engineered to produce energetic, creative, and uplifted effects. These qualities make the cultivar well-suited for social interactions, focus-intensive tasks, and creative pursuits. The variety has also contributed to the broader cannabis gene pool, serving as a parent to notable offspring such as Kool Aid Man.

Research notes below describe isolated terpene mechanisms and early findings. They do not guarantee effects from this strain and are not medical advice.

~60%

spicy

●●○○

Russo 2011: only terpene that is a selective full CB2 agonist (100 nM); Gertsch et al. 2008: acts as dietary cannabinoid; unique anti-inflammatory and gastric cytoprotective properties.

~28%

citrus

●●○○

Russo 2011: increases serotonin in prefrontal cortex + dopamine in hippocampus via 5-HT1A; Johns Hopkins 2024: significantly reduced anxiety vs THC alone.

~12%

earthy

●○○○

PMC11060501: opioid-independent antinociception; appetite suppression (anorectic); NF-κB dual-pathway synergy with caryophyllene.
